Axed Arsenal talent spotter opens up on departure
The former Arsenal scout who unearthed the likes of Cesc Fabregas and Hector Bellerin insists that he is not bitter about his sudden departure.
Francis Cagigao spent more than two decades with the Gunners, having joined the club when Arsene Wenger was the manager.
Arsenal officially announced his departure at the beginning of this month, on the back of the club confirming in August that they had proposed 55 redundancies to staff due to the coronavirus pandemic.
In an interview with Guillem Balague on the Pure Football Podcast, he was asked why he was not staying on at the Emirates Stadium.
Cagigao said: “That’s not really a question I can answer. That’s a question for somebody else.
“You can’t afford to be bitter in life. You have to have a thick skin and get over things quickly.”
Raya lined up as Martinez replacement
Arsenal have opened talks over a possible deal to sign Brentford goalkeeper David Raya, according to Sports Mole.
The Spaniard kept 16 clean sheets last season and the Bees are reluctant to lose the 24-year-old.
However, with Emiliano Martinez set to move to Aston Villa, Arsenal manager Mikel Arteta wants to land a replacement back-up option to regular No.1 Bernd Leno.

Raya was not in the Brentford squad for their game against Birmingham City on Saturday, which they lost 1-0.
Lacazette "will be pushed by Nketiah" – Arteta
Alexandre Lacazette looks set to stay at Arsenal – despite Arteta warning him that fellow striker Eddie Nketiah will be ready to take his place if he does not keep his foot on the gas.
Arteta was delighted with the Frenchman’s performance on Saturday as Arsenal beat Fulham 3-0 at Craven Cottage, but warned him that youngster Nketiah is waiting on the sidelines.

"Yes, he is in my plans, he’s a player I like a lot," Arteta told BT Sport. "But he knows he has Eddie on his back or next to him and he’s going to push him.
"Whoever is in better shape is going to play and it’s the same for the rest of the team."
Lacazette has been linked with Juventus and Atletico Madrid over the summer.
